Biography
Jean-François Garand (1678-1778) was a French goldsmith and enamellist known for his exquisite craftsmanship. Garand's work is characterized by intricate floral motifs, delicate enamel work, and a rich gold background. His pieces, like this ornate oval snuff box, are often adorned with a variety of flowers, leaves, and scrolls, showcasing his meticulous attention to detail and mastery of enamel techniques. Garand's creations were highly prized by the French aristocracy, reflecting the opulence and refinement of the era.
